What many people don't realize is that buffalo play a crucial role in ecosystem engineering. Their wallowing behavior creates depressions that become temporary wetlands supporting entire communities of plants and animals. I've cataloged over 47 different species that directly benefit from these buffalo-created habitats. Their grazing patterns help maintain prairie biodiversity by preventing any single plant species from dominating the landscape. The story of buffalo conservation is particularly close to my heart. From populations numbering approximately 60 million in the early 19th century, they were hunted to near extinction with only 541 individuals remaining by 1889. The recovery to today's population of around 31,000 wild buffalo represents one of conservation's greatest success stories, though we still have work to do.
